HAS Autumn Beach Festival Results

Harsh rainfall from the off greeted the 14 anglers who took part in the Herons autumn beach festival on Saturday 9th November but this thankfully died off after the first hour or so and resulted in a pleasant evenings fishing.
G. Mummery set the tone with an early bass of 2.46lbs from outside the club house with plenty of whiting and a few dogfish being caught by others. Weed was reportedly a real problem for those fishing the Reculver end of the town but fish were evidently still present amongst it.
With M. Morris taking the lead on day one with 16 fish for 9.06lbs, closely followed by brothers S. Mummery and G. Mummery, there was still all to play for.
Sundays conditions were a stark contrast to the calm evening of Saturday and blustery NW winds prevailed throughout the competition. Catches slowed as a result but having only fished half of Saturdays competition, it was B. Morris who took the podiums' top spot for Sunday with 15 fish for 9.28lbs including a club specimen flounder of 1.10lbs.
Unfortunately for M. Morris, he couldn't mange to retain his lead after Sundays event and with S. Mummery bowing out on the second day due to family commitments it was T. Morris who capitalised and won the competition overall with a total weight of 15.74lbs.
